ReeceZ wrote:
rat wrote:what you think about mounting them under the radio?
I've got my boost and oil pressure there, don't suggest it if ur going to make reference to it often. If u drive leaning back, the shifter can sometimes block line of sight
That why i moved my radio down and fitted my gauges above the radio.
